We're looking for a Game Scout to join our Publishing team and build a stable pipeline of new mobile game studios and projects. You'll be responsible for the full acquisition cycle — from finding promising studios and identifying the right decision-makers to initiating communication, presenting Hypercell, and bringing interested studios to registration in Studio Portal. This is a highly proactive, outbound-focused role for someone who enjoys finding new contacts, starting conversations from scratch, and turning them into real business opportunities.

What are you working on?
  • Genres: Shooter, Hyper-casual, Puzzle, Casual
  • Platforms: Mobile, iOS, Android
For which tasks (responsibilities)?
  • Search for new mobile game studios and projects that could be a good fit for Hypercell.
  • Build and manage your own pipeline of potential publishing partners.
  • Identify founders, producers, Business Development managers, and other decision-makers within target studios.
  • Conduct outbound outreach through LinkedIn, email, Discord, Telegram, professional communities, and other relevant channels.
  • Use follow-ups, alternative contacts, and different communication channels to establish contact with studios that don't respond initially.
  • Conduct initial qualification of studios and games and assess their potential fit with Hypercell's publishing focus.
  • Conduct introductory calls with studios and present Hypercell and its publishing process.
  • Answer initial questions about publishing, game testing, metrics, and potential cooperation.
  • Handle objections and develop communication with interested studios.
  • Use your professional network and mutual connections to generate introductions and new opportunities.
  • Bring interested studios to registration in Studio Portal.
  • Maintain accurate lead statuses, contacts, and next steps in Studio Portal.
  • Transfer registered studios to the Publishing Operations Associate with all relevant context from previous communication.
  • Maintain relationships with acquired studios and re-engage them when relevant.
  • Participate in international gaming conferences and professional events when needed, helping build relationships and expand the studio network.
